This course will not only cover basic concepts in leadership, such as the difference between social dominance and influence-based leadership, it will also help students reflect systematically upon their own experiences with leadership and with Biblical examples of principles related to leadership. They will learn basic 'meta-theoretical' ways of understanding leadership, e.g., by considering leader, follower, context, process, and outcome in each leadership situation. Students will discuss and compare their socio-cultural contexts and how they have experienced leadership in a variety of settings: within the Church, within their congregation, within their school, helath care facility or organization, and in their country.
